NBCC (India) Limited — Investor Meet, 15-01-2025: Analysts/Institutional Investor Meet/Con. Call Updates
1. **Financial Performance**: NBCC reported a consolidated revenue growth of 15.51%, reaching ₹80,506 crore, along with an impressive EBITDA increase of 25.53% and a PAT jump of 45.83%. The strong increase in profit after tax to ₹3,444 crore indicates a robust performance, driven by improved operational efficiencies. Standalone figures also showed positive trends with a 12.65% rise in revenue and a PAT growth of 41.71%.
2. **Future Outlook and Growth Drivers**: Management highlighted plans to enhance revenue streams through increased international business and public sector collaborations. The company is targeting growth in the real estate redevelopment sector and aims to address stalled projects, which are a significant focus area.
3. **Order Book and Operational Updates**: The consolidated order book stands at an impressive ₹1 trillion, bolstered by securing key contracts, including a major ₹127,120 crore satellite township project in Srinagar and other significant redevelopment projects in Goa and Delhi.
